The Rise of Sports Technology in the Digital Era

Sports have always evolved alongside technology. From synthetic tracks to instant replay, innovation has consistently reshaped competition. Today, however, the pace of change is unprecedented.

We are witnessing a convergence of:

  • Artificial intelligence
  • Wearable performance tracking
  • Real-time data analytics
  • Esports ecosystems
  • Virtual and augmented reality training

This integration is not just about enhancing performance—it’s about building smarter systems that learn, adapt, and predict outcomes.

Modern athletes rely on GPS trackers, heart-rate monitors, biomechanical sensors, and recovery analytics to optimize every aspect of their performance. Coaches access live dashboards during matches. Teams analyze predictive injury models to protect players. The digital layer of sports is now inseparable from the physical one.

The Core Technologies Powering Modern Sports

Understanding the tools behind transformation helps clarify why platforms like Etesportech.org matter.

Wearable Technology

Wearables track physiological metrics in real time, including:

  • Heart rate variability
  • Oxygen saturation
  • Acceleration and deceleration
  • Recovery cycles

These insights enable coaches to personalize training regimens.

Artificial Intelligence in Sports Strategy

AI systems analyze vast datasets to:

  • Predict opponent behavior
  • Optimize lineup strategies
  • Simulate game scenarios
  • Identify performance patterns invisible to the human eye

AI is not replacing coaches—it’s augmenting decision-making.

Biomechanics and Motion Capture

High-speed cameras and motion capture systems analyze body alignment, stride efficiency, and muscle engagement. Minor adjustments can lead to significant performance gains.

Competitive gaming has transformed from entertainment into professional sport. Reaction speed, focus endurance, and neural efficiency are now measurable factors.

Cognitive Training Technologies

Professional esports athletes use:

  • Neurofeedback systems
  • Eye-tracking technology
  • Reaction-speed analytics tools

These systems enhance mental stamina and decision-making precision.

Performance Optimization Beyond Gaming

Insights from esports training are influencing traditional sports. Reaction training drills inspired by gaming platforms are now used in football, basketball, and tennis.

The convergence demonstrates how interconnected modern performance science has become.

Injury Prevention Through Predictive Technology

One of the most powerful uses of sports tech is injury prevention.

Load Monitoring Systems

Tracking cumulative physical stress helps detect:

  • Overtraining risks
  • Muscular imbalance
  • Fatigue thresholds

Preventive action can extend athlete careers and reduce downtime.

Recovery Optimization

Advanced systems monitor:

  • Sleep quality
  • Hormonal balance
  • Inflammation markers

Personalized recovery plans ensure optimal performance sustainability.

The Future of Smart Sports Ecosystems

The next wave of transformation includes:

  • AI-powered refereeing systems
  • Fully immersive VR training camps
  • Blockchain-based athlete contracts
  • Real-time biometric broadcasting

Sports will become increasingly transparent, measurable, and interactive.

The lines between athlete, analyst, and technologist are blurring.
